磁处理水对家兔血脂影响的实验研究

摘    要:目的:探讨饮用磁处理水时间的长短与降低家兔血脂的关系。方法:72只家兔平均分四组A组基础饲料组,饮自来水;B、C、D高脂饲料组,B组对照组饮自来水;C组治疗1组,30天后饮磁处理水,治疗30天后采耳血,分别测血清TC、TG、HDL-c、LDL-c水平。D组治疗2组,30天后饮磁处理水,治疗100天后采耳血,分别测血清TC、TG、HDL-c、LDL-c水平。结果:B组家兔血清TC、TG、HDL-c、LDL-c水平显著高于A组,(P<0.01);C组家兔TC、LDL-c水平显著低与B组(P<0.01);,但也显著高于A组(P<0.01);TG、HDL-c水平与B组相比无显著差异(P>0.05)。D组家兔血清TC、TG、LDL-c水平与B组相比均有明显下降(P<0.01),与A组比较差异无显著性(P>0.05),而HDL-c水平与A组比较明显上升(P<0.01)。结论:长期饮用磁处理水可以显著降低家兔血清高胆固醇含量,并恢复到正常状态。

Effect of Magnetized Water Feeding in Blood Fat Level of Rabbits

Abstract:Objective: To study the relationship between the length of magnetized water feeding and the decreasing of blood fat of rabbits. Methods: 72 rabbits were equally divided into four groups: group A was given regular diet with running water; group B(i.e. experimental control group), group C(i.e. treatment group 1) and group D(i.e. treatment group 2) were all given diet rich in fat also with running water; in addition, after 30 days, group C and D were treated with magnetized water feeding. The levels of serum TC, TG, HDL-C and LDL-C in group C(after 60 days) and group D(after 130 days) were examined by enzymic method. Results: The levels of serum TC, TG, HDL-C and LDL-C in group B were much higher than those in group A(P<0.01). Compared with group B, the levels of serum TC and LDL-C in group C were markedly lower (P<0.01), but higher than those in group A(P<0.01), there was no significant difference in serum TG, and HDL-C(p>0.05). The levels of serum TC, TG and LDL-C in group D were obviously lower than those in group B (P<0.01), compared with those in group A, there was no significant difference(P>0.05), but the level of serum HDL-C increased greatly(P<0.01). Conclusion: For the rabbits with Hyperlipemia, long-term magnetized water feeding can increase the level of serum HDL-C, which can reduce blood fat, even to the normal range.
